由买买提看人间百态

boards

本页内容为未名空间相应帖子的节选和存档,一周内的贴子最多显示50字,超过一周显示500字 访问原贴
Programming版 - 给点学习建议吧
相关主题
java和swift还是缺一不可怎么开发网站和相关app?
Ruby这么好的语言,衰落的也太可惜了。这次Node把GAE也给干了
nodejs 流行的原因编程入门学什么c啊,从实用角度出发,学swift
nosql有一个好处就是看来Go很有潜力
正式跳了linux的坑了看来2013还是Javascript最流行
魏老师这次给一群失意者们带来了希望这两天趁国内放假写了个网站
现在开发新网站是php还是nodejs?求推荐database的软件 (转载)
弱问下,UBER后台用的是啥?我看这个所谓的铁道部售票系统
相关话题的讨论汇总
话题: app话题: 浏览器话题: swift话题: android话题: 学习
进入Programming版参与讨论
1 (共1页)
h*******3
发帖数: 122
1
现在java后端,一个中型公司,还算年轻,除了刷题跳槽,学做PPT外,大牛说说若时
间有限,技术
方面学啥好些?想到的几个选择:
1.Scala
2.Android
3. js 和 nodejs
若只选一个的话,因为想多花点时间在某个上面,觉的2个一学起没有时间
h*******3
发帖数: 122
2
好吧,自己分析下。
scala难学,而且用处并不广泛,估计自学了换地方也不一定能用的上
android感觉值的学吧,将来肯定是app的天下,当然swift也应该学
js和node感觉应用更多吧,似乎也应该学,但感觉没有android那么直接

【在 h*******3 的大作中提到】
: 现在java后端,一个中型公司,还算年轻,除了刷题跳槽,学做PPT外,大牛说说若时
: 间有限,技术
: 方面学啥好些?想到的几个选择:
: 1.Scala
: 2.Android
: 3. js 和 nodejs
: 若只选一个的话,因为想多花点时间在某个上面,觉的2个一学起没有时间

d*******r
发帖数: 3299
3
你列出来的几选一的话,学 nodejs 最划算,因为以后做 web 一定会用的
我最近都在用 Python, 不过从你给的 list 里,还是推荐 node

【在 h*******3 的大作中提到】
: 现在java后端,一个中型公司,还算年轻,除了刷题跳槽,学做PPT外,大牛说说若时
: 间有限,技术
: 方面学啥好些?想到的几个选择:
: 1.Scala
: 2.Android
: 3. js 和 nodejs
: 若只选一个的话,因为想多花点时间在某个上面,觉的2个一学起没有时间

g*****g
发帖数: 34805
4
不如学 NoSQL.

【在 h*******3 的大作中提到】
: 现在java后端,一个中型公司,还算年轻,除了刷题跳槽,学做PPT外,大牛说说若时
: 间有限,技术
: 方面学啥好些?想到的几个选择:
: 1.Scala
: 2.Android
: 3. js 和 nodejs
: 若只选一个的话,因为想多花点时间在某个上面,觉的2个一学起没有时间

z****e
发帖数: 54598
5
学习主要是领悟精神,掌握理论
所以建议学习-> vert.x
接触各种新生事物,将来真要用了,你就算不懂
也不会什么都说不出来不是?
z****e
发帖数: 54598
6

学vert.x,你可以接触各种东西,这是server side
如果你想扩展你对于app的知识,建议直接上swift
所以swift + vert.x
你懂了vert.x之后,我觉得什么node, akka之类的,都不难
因为本来很多东西就是互相抄的,等真用了再补足剩下的不迟
这个面就广了,你还能明白rxjava, streaming, nosql这些
vert.x对这些新兴的东西支持非常好,官方直接发布包教你怎么搞
swift的话,用xcode来搞,听说apple秋季打算放出大招
在app上搞广告拦截,如果这个真的搞出来了
android跟ios的差距会进一步拉大
因为本来android的体验就不如ios,如果没有了广告,那后果不堪设想
google几乎不可能限制android上的广告投放,狗就靠这个活着的了

【在 h*******3 的大作中提到】
: 好吧,自己分析下。
: scala难学,而且用处并不广泛,估计自学了换地方也不一定能用的上
: android感觉值的学吧,将来肯定是app的天下,当然swift也应该学
: js和node感觉应用更多吧,似乎也应该学,但感觉没有android那么直接

b******y
发帖数: 9224
7

不认为将来是app的天下。app和90年代给windows做软件一样了。开发小软件,没啥前
途,相当于唱配角的。
还是做server side更好,技术上有很多精深的东西,对公司更加核心,更加重要。你
看,公司想做app,随便就外包了,可服务器端的工作,公司都是死死攥着的。
App就是个interface, 变化快,累,还不如server side挣钱。
商业上,App最大的问题就是,受制于平台。好比给windows开发软件,一旦你开发的被
平台看上了,人家马上把你搞死,或者好一点就收购你了。当年那么多给windows开发
的,对微软是既爱又恨,就是这个道理。
Web不依赖于平台,所以发展前景更好。
当然,这世界上工作有分工,世界需要ceo, 世界也需要清洁工,至于自己想做啥,哪
个适合自己,就看你自己的选择了。

【在 h*******3 的大作中提到】
: 好吧,自己分析下。
: scala难学,而且用处并不广泛,估计自学了换地方也不一定能用的上
: android感觉值的学吧,将来肯定是app的天下,当然swift也应该学
: js和node感觉应用更多吧,似乎也应该学,但感觉没有android那么直接

h*******3
发帖数: 122
8
I agree. But I want to learn some extra stuff during my spare time.

【在 b******y 的大作中提到】
:
: 不认为将来是app的天下。app和90年代给windows做软件一样了。开发小软件,没啥前
: 途,相当于唱配角的。
: 还是做server side更好,技术上有很多精深的东西,对公司更加核心,更加重要。你
: 看,公司想做app,随便就外包了,可服务器端的工作,公司都是死死攥着的。
: App就是个interface, 变化快,累,还不如server side挣钱。
: 商业上,App最大的问题就是,受制于平台。好比给windows开发软件,一旦你开发的被
: 平台看上了,人家马上把你搞死,或者好一点就收购你了。当年那么多给windows开发
: 的,对微软是既爱又恨,就是这个道理。
: Web不依赖于平台,所以发展前景更好。

h*******3
发帖数: 122
9
Monogo, C*?

【在 g*****g 的大作中提到】
: 不如学 NoSQL.
h*******3
发帖数: 122
10
which company uses vert.x now?

【在 z****e 的大作中提到】
:
: 学vert.x,你可以接触各种东西,这是server side
: 如果你想扩展你对于app的知识,建议直接上swift
: 所以swift + vert.x
: 你懂了vert.x之后,我觉得什么node, akka之类的,都不难
: 因为本来很多东西就是互相抄的,等真用了再补足剩下的不迟
: 这个面就广了,你还能明白rxjava, streaming, nosql这些
: vert.x对这些新兴的东西支持非常好,官方直接发布包教你怎么搞
: swift的话,用xcode来搞,听说apple秋季打算放出大招
: 在app上搞广告拦截,如果这个真的搞出来了

相关主题
魏老师这次给一群失意者们带来了希望怎么开发网站和相关app?
现在开发新网站是php还是nodejs?这次Node把GAE也给干了
弱问下,UBER后台用的是啥?编程入门学什么c啊,从实用角度出发,学swift
进入Programming版参与讨论
ET
发帖数: 10701
11
这里面是又有语言,又有framework, node.js说自己不是framework
我觉得学framework更实际些。
工作是后端,就学前端;工作是前端,自己业余就学后端。
当然,学不如做实际项目。

【在 h*******3 的大作中提到】
: 现在java后端,一个中型公司,还算年轻,除了刷题跳槽,学做PPT外,大牛说说若时
: 间有限,技术
: 方面学啥好些?想到的几个选择:
: 1.Scala
: 2.Android
: 3. js 和 nodejs
: 若只选一个的话,因为想多花点时间在某个上面,觉的2个一学起没有时间

g*****g
发帖数: 34805
12
搜一堆对口的工作,找三个频度出现最高但是不会的关键字去学最靠谱了。
z****e
发帖数: 54598
13
不少,还都是好公司,不过你态度有问题,学习最重要的是掌握原理,纠缠于实现细节
的话,就是瞎子摸象,因为这些东西经常换,原理一致,各种实现会大博弈,自由市场
就是这样,应该以不变应万变,否则换个东西你就不会了,而且你搞java的,怎么也该
听说过red hat(jboss)和vmware(spring)的威名

:which company uses vert.x now?
:【 在 zhaoce (米高蜥蜴) 的大作中提到: 】
h*******3
发帖数: 122
14
https://jobs.netflix.com/jobs/1469/apply

【在 g*****g 的大作中提到】
: 搜一堆对口的工作,找三个频度出现最高但是不会的关键字去学最靠谱了。
n*****t
发帖数: 22014
15
JS 在未来很长时间将主宰浏览器,浏览器在未来很长时间将主宰互联网,互联网在未
来很长时间将主宰 IT

【在 h*******3 的大作中提到】
: 现在java后端,一个中型公司,还算年轻,除了刷题跳槽,学做PPT外,大牛说说若时
: 间有限,技术
: 方面学啥好些?想到的几个选择:
: 1.Scala
: 2.Android
: 3. js 和 nodejs
: 若只选一个的话,因为想多花点时间在某个上面,觉的2个一学起没有时间

z****e
发帖数: 54598
16

第二步错了,移动互联显然比浏览器更有前途,最近股票涨的主因都是mobile

【在 n*****t 的大作中提到】
: JS 在未来很长时间将主宰浏览器,浏览器在未来很长时间将主宰互联网,互联网在未
: 来很长时间将主宰 IT

n*****t
发帖数: 22014
17
我说的浏览器是广义浏览器,各种 app 的本质还是一个浏览器的马甲。另外我说的不
是最近,是未来。

【在 z****e 的大作中提到】
:
: 第二步错了,移动互联显然比浏览器更有前途,最近股票涨的主因都是mobile

z****e
发帖数: 54598
18

各种app本质其实不是浏览器,六成左右都是偏native的应用
表达力更强,浏览器脚本模式表达能力太弱了,一天到晚就折腾各种table
要想有更好的体验,肯定需求不只这一点
这就是为啥app比浏览器更有前途的原因,表达能力更强
能做更多的事,而不仅仅是crud那么简单
能做更多的事之后,自然就拥有更大的市场

【在 n*****t 的大作中提到】
: 我说的浏览器是广义浏览器,各种 app 的本质还是一个浏览器的马甲。另外我说的不
: 是最近,是未来。

h*******3
发帖数: 122
19
so, I should learn swift and android?

【在 z****e 的大作中提到】
:
: 各种app本质其实不是浏览器,六成左右都是偏native的应用
: 表达力更强,浏览器脚本模式表达能力太弱了,一天到晚就折腾各种table
: 要想有更好的体验,肯定需求不只这一点
: 这就是为啥app比浏览器更有前途的原因,表达能力更强
: 能做更多的事,而不仅仅是crud那么简单
: 能做更多的事之后,自然就拥有更大的市场

s********k
发帖数: 6180
20
其实APP更强本质上是人在手机上花的时间比电脑多太多,而且越来越多,APP用的更定
就比浏览器多了,手机上用浏览器的估计没啥人吧

【在 z****e 的大作中提到】
:
: 各种app本质其实不是浏览器,六成左右都是偏native的应用
: 表达力更强,浏览器脚本模式表达能力太弱了,一天到晚就折腾各种table
: 要想有更好的体验,肯定需求不只这一点
: 这就是为啥app比浏览器更有前途的原因,表达能力更强
: 能做更多的事,而不仅仅是crud那么简单
: 能做更多的事之后,自然就拥有更大的市场

相关主题
看来Go很有潜力求推荐database的软件 (转载)
看来2013还是Javascript最流行我看这个所谓的铁道部售票系统
这两天趁国内放假写了个网站Node做大系统better than Java, .NET
进入Programming版参与讨论
s********k
发帖数: 6180
21
APP和浏览器马甲差太远吧,APP上很多功能浏览器提供起来都很费劲或者低效,不如说
手机上浏览器是一个APP的备胎,如果有一个同样的服务有APP和流浪器(web link),
打开浏览器的估计少之又少

【在 n*****t 的大作中提到】
: 我说的浏览器是广义浏览器,各种 app 的本质还是一个浏览器的马甲。另外我说的不
: 是最近,是未来。

z****e
发帖数: 54598
22

你的主业是server,做app如果不是自己创业的话
相当于小转行,不合适,但是放弃自己创业又有些可惜
所以可以业余搞,server side把vert.x好好弄弄
理解原理,表纠缠细节,就跟你学spring那些一样

【在 h*******3 的大作中提到】
: so, I should learn swift and android?
n*****t
发帖数: 22014
23
App 更多时候只是为了提高你的粘着度,最主要的功能就是省却你打开浏览器这一步。
你看各大 retail 的 app,跟他们的 web 几乎没啥不同。
不要跟我说赵老师的 pvp,那是理工索南琢磨的。

【在 s********k 的大作中提到】
: APP和浏览器马甲差太远吧,APP上很多功能浏览器提供起来都很费劲或者低效,不如说
: 手机上浏览器是一个APP的备胎,如果有一个同样的服务有APP和流浪器(web link),
: 打开浏览器的估计少之又少

s********k
发帖数: 6180
24
各大retail的APP半月不用一回,随便说高频的那些:wechat,FB,uber,Instagram,
这些,要么根本没浏览器版本,要么浏览器在手机上忽略不计。

【在 n*****t 的大作中提到】
: App 更多时候只是为了提高你的粘着度,最主要的功能就是省却你打开浏览器这一步。
: 你看各大 retail 的 app,跟他们的 web 几乎没啥不同。
: 不要跟我说赵老师的 pvp,那是理工索南琢磨的。

n*****t
发帖数: 22014
25
呵呵,看吧,这个世界最终赚钱的是 ecom 还是 social media

【在 s********k 的大作中提到】
: 各大retail的APP半月不用一回,随便说高频的那些:wechat,FB,uber,Instagram,
: 这些,要么根本没浏览器版本,要么浏览器在手机上忽略不计。

z****e
发帖数: 54598
26

没说不赚钱,但是这些领域已经被人做烂了,再捣腾也倒腾不出多少水花来
无非混个工作而已,跟在其他企业里面打工没啥太大区别

【在 n*****t 的大作中提到】
: 呵呵,看吧,这个世界最终赚钱的是 ecom 还是 social media
g*****g
发帖数: 34805
27
浏览器已经不主宰互联网了。

【在 n*****t 的大作中提到】
: JS 在未来很长时间将主宰浏览器,浏览器在未来很长时间将主宰互联网,互联网在未
: 来很长时间将主宰 IT

1 (共1页)
进入Programming版参与讨论
相关主题
我看这个所谓的铁道部售票系统正式跳了linux的坑了
Node做大系统better than Java, .NET魏老师这次给一群失意者们带来了希望
异步的话,所有语言都有自己的环境现在开发新网站是php还是nodejs?
对非程序员而言,好虫的架构很有问题弱问下,UBER后台用的是啥?
java和swift还是缺一不可怎么开发网站和相关app?
Ruby这么好的语言,衰落的也太可惜了。这次Node把GAE也给干了
nodejs 流行的原因编程入门学什么c啊,从实用角度出发,学swift
nosql有一个好处就是看来Go很有潜力
相关话题的讨论汇总
话题: app话题: 浏览器话题: swift话题: android话题: 学习